Marjorie Barretto couldn’t help but feel sentimental as she marked the 40th day since the sudden death of Mito, the eldest among her siblings.
Barretto took to her Instagram page on Saturday, November 1, to express how much she missed her older brother since his death. The post also contained a photo of the actress holding Mito’s framed photo and glimpses of herself bonding with the latter’s family.
‘[Fortieth] day without you, Mito. They say the soul’s journey ends today. You are free now, surrounded by light and peace, watching over us with the same quiet strength you always had. There is not a moment for the past 40 days that I do not think of you,’ she said.
Barretto also confessed that she feels her older brother’s loss ‘more and more every day,’ while vowing that she loves him forever.
‘I feel your loss more and more everyday. I miss you so much. We all do. You would have been happy to see us celebrate you today. We love you always and forever,’ she said.
The actress-politician recently made headlines after her mother Inday accused her of stirring a rivalry between her sisters Gretchen and Claudine, and herself due to ‘inggit (envy)’ in a two-part interview with entertainment insider Ogie Diaz.
Inday also alleged that she wasn’t invited to Marjorie’s parties and other gatherings because the latter is ’embarrassed’ of her.
This led Marjorie to deny Inday’s claims in a lengthy statement last October 29, with the actress calling out her mother for turning her into some sort of a ‘damage control’ to make her youngest child ‘look clean,’ in an apparent reference to Claudine. At the same time, she also expressed her fury for causing a stir amid Mito’s wake.
‘Am I once again damage control? The Mission: Destroy Marjorie – to make the youngest child look good and clean,’ she said. ‘With my mom, if you are not a problematic child, you become the least favorite.’
